WebAug 6, 2024 · Now the most commonly performed eye laser surgery, LASIK involves creating a partial-thickness corneal flap and using an excimer laser to ablate the bed of the cornea. The flap is then placed back into its original position. Discomfort after surgery is minimal, and vision recovery usually takes place in 1 to 2 days.

Blink often WebAug 18, 2024 · In a ball flow indicator, flow moves a ball from the bottom of the indicator housing to a position at the top of the sight window. The suspension of the ball by the fluid indicates the presence of flow. This style of the indicator must be applied in vertical pipes with upward flow.
